Armed Robber of Metro Detroit Walgreens Sentenced to 28 Years in Prison

A spate of armed robberies that terrorized Metro Detroit Walgreens employees has come to a close as the criminal behind the spree, Mario Keeream Jackson, 35, faces 28 years behind bars. FOX 2 reported that the Detroit native was sentenced this week for multiple drugstore robberies across Oak Park, Dearborn Heights, Royal Oak, and Warren, in addition to an attempted robbery in Southfield.

While on probation, Jackson employed a unique method to enter the establishments, scaling coolers to reach the safes located at the back. He committed four successful robberies before being apprehended in May 2019 during a police search at his girlfriend's Detroit residence, where authorities recovered over $18,000, more than 5,000 prescription opioid pills, and the gun used, in the crimes.

Jackson's sentence also reflects his past, as he previously held convictions for weapons and drug charges. "This defendant wreaked havoc in our community for more than five months, committing a string of armed robberies against innocent victims," said U.S. Attorney Ison, according to the announcement from the Eastern District of Michigan. The Department of Justice emphasizes this sentencing underscores their commitment to mitigating such violence from the community.

Totaling nine, employees were held at gunpoint throughout the ordeal. Cheyvoryea Gibson, Special Agent in Charge of the FBI in Michigan, thanked the Oakland County Gang and Violent Crime Task Force and their partners for their collaborative efforts in this case. "This sentence serves as a warning to violent criminals and demonstrates the FBI’s and its law enforcement partners’ dedication to ensuring safer communities," Gibson told the Eastern District of Michigan.

The investigation and subsequent prosecution were part of Project Safe Neighborhoods (PSN), a nationwide initiative aimed at reducing violent crime. Combining local law enforcement and community stakeholders, PSN targets the most pressing violent crime issues and develops comprehensive solutions to address them, focusing on the most violent offenders while also supporting prevention and reentry programs.
